Garnet Color Chart - Garnets are a group of mineral s that are very much alike. Garnets have fair to good toughness, making them durable enough for all jewelry styles as long as they are treated with the proper care. There are more than twenty garnet categories, called species, but only five are commercially important as gems. The importance of color in gems has led to the association by gemologists of very particular colors with the various types of garnets: Red garnets have a long history, but modern gem buyers can pick from a rich palette of garnet colors: Greens, oranges, pinkish oranges, deeply saturated purplish reds, and even some blues.
